├── .editorconfig ├── .eslintrc.js ├── .github └── workflows │ ├── docs-bundle.yml │ ├── docs-publish-dev.yml │ └── docs-publish-prod.yml ├── .gitignore ├── .husky └── pre-push ├── Changelog.md ├── LICENSE ├── README.md ├── doc ├── docs │ ├── adding_uuid_defs.md │ ├── advertising_setup.md │ ├── connecting_devices.md │ ├── dfu.md │ ├── index.md │ ├── installing.md │ ├── maintaining_server_setup.md │ ├── overview_and_ui.md │ ├── pairing_devices.md │ ├── revision_history.md │ ├── screenshots │ │ ├── Secure_DFU_button.png │ │ ├── device_options.PNG │ │ ├── discovered_devices.PNG │ │ ├── discovered_devices_example.PNG │ │ ├── expand-collapse.png │ │ ├── nRF_Connect_enable_notifications.png │ │ ├── nRF_Connect_for_Desktop_BLE_about.png │ │ ├── nRF_connect_advertising_setup.png │ │ ├── nRF_connect_app_window.png │ │ ├── nRF_connect_dfu_completed.png │ │ ├── nRF_connect_dfu_progress.png │ │ ├── nRF_connect_dfu_start.png │ │ ├── nRF_connect_discovered_services.png │ │ ├── nRF_connect_hovering_over_padlock.png │ │ ├── nRF_connect_local_device.png │ │ ├── nRF_connect_pairing.png │ │ ├── nRF_connect_secure_dfu.png │ │ ├── nRF_connect_server_setup.png │ │ ├── nRF_connect_servicedetails.png │ │ ├── nRF_connect_update_connection.png │ │ ├── nrfconnect_ble_program_prompt.png │ │ ├── padlock_encrypted.png │ │ ├── padlock_unencrypted.png │ │ └── server_setup.PNG │ ├── service_discovery.md │ ├── setting_up_application.md │ ├── troubleshooting.md │ └── update_connection.md ├── mkdocs.yml └── zoomin │ ├── custom.properties │ └── tags.yml ├── jest.config.js ├── package.json ├── resources ├── dfu_icon.png ├── icon.icns ├── icon.ico ├── icon.png ├── icon.svg └── screenshot.gif ├── src ├── config.ts ├── downloadInstaller.ts ├── index.tsx ├── paths.ts ├── run.ts └── style.css └── tsconfig.json /.editorconfig: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/NordicSemiconductor/pc-nrfconnect-ble/HEAD/.editorconfig -------------------------------------------------------------------------------- /.eslintrc.js: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/NordicSemiconductor/pc-nrfconnect-ble/HEAD/.eslintrc.js -------------------------------------------------------------------------------- /.github/workflows/docs-bundle.yml: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/NordicSemiconductor/pc-nrfconnect-ble/HEAD/.github/workflows/docs-bundle.yml -------------------------------------------------------------------------------- /.github/workflows/docs-publish-dev.yml: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/NordicSemiconductor/pc-nrfconnect-ble/HEAD/.github/workflows/docs-publish-dev.yml -------------------------------------------------------------------------------- /.github/workflows/docs-publish-prod.yml: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/NordicSemiconductor/pc-nrfconnect-ble/HEAD/.github/workflows/docs-publish-prod.yml -------------------------------------------------------------------------------- /.gitignore: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/NordicSemiconductor/pc-nrfconnect-ble/HEAD/.gitignore -------------------------------------------------------------------------------- /.husky/pre-push: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/NordicSemiconductor/pc-nrfconnect-ble/HEAD/.husky/pre-push -------------------------------------------------------------------------------- /Changelog.md: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/NordicSemiconductor/pc-nrfconnect-ble/HEAD/Changelog.md -------------------------------------------------------------------------------- /LICENSE: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/NordicSemiconductor/pc-nrfconnect-ble/HEAD/LICENSE -------------------------------------------------------------------------------- /README.md: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/NordicSemiconductor/pc-nrfconnect-ble/HEAD/README.md -------------------------------------------------------------------------------- /doc/docs/adding_uuid_defs.md: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/NordicSemiconductor/pc-nrfconnect-ble/HEAD/doc/docs/adding_uuid_defs.md -------------------------------------------------------------------------------- /doc/docs/advertising_setup.md: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/NordicSemiconductor/pc-nrfconnect-ble/HEAD/doc/docs/advertising_setup.md -------------------------------------------------------------------------------- /doc/docs/connecting_devices.md: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/NordicSemiconductor/pc-nrfconnect-ble/HEAD/doc/docs/connecting_devices.md -------------------------------------------------------------------------------- /doc/docs/dfu.md: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/NordicSemiconductor/pc-nrfconnect-ble/HEAD/doc/docs/dfu.md -------------------------------------------------------------------------------- /doc/docs/index.md: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/NordicSemiconductor/pc-nrfconnect-ble/HEAD/doc/docs/index.md -------------------------------------------------------------------------------- /doc/docs/installing.md: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/NordicSemiconductor/pc-nrfconnect-ble/HEAD/doc/docs/installing.md -------------------------------------------------------------------------------- /doc/docs/maintaining_server_setup.md: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/NordicSemiconductor/pc-nrfconnect-ble/HEAD/doc/docs/maintaining_server_setup.md -------------------------------------------------------------------------------- /doc/docs/overview_and_ui.md: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/NordicSemiconductor/pc-nrfconnect-ble/HEAD/doc/docs/overview_and_ui.md -------------------------------------------------------------------------------- /doc/docs/pairing_devices.md: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/NordicSemiconductor/pc-nrfconnect-ble/HEAD/doc/docs/pairing_devices.md -------------------------------------------------------------------------------- /doc/docs/revision_history.md: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/NordicSemiconductor/pc-nrfconnect-ble/HEAD/doc/docs/revision_history.md -------------------------------------------------------------------------------- /doc/docs/screenshots/Secure_DFU_button.png: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/NordicSemiconductor/pc-nrfconnect-ble/HEAD/doc/docs/screenshots/Secure_DFU_button.png -------------------------------------------------------------------------------- /doc/docs/screenshots/device_options.PNG: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/NordicSemiconductor/pc-nrfconnect-ble/HEAD/doc/docs/screenshots/device_options.PNG -------------------------------------------------------------------------------- /doc/docs/screenshots/discovered_devices.PNG: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/NordicSemiconductor/pc-nrfconnect-ble/HEAD/doc/docs/screenshots/discovered_devices.PNG -------------------------------------------------------------------------------- /doc/docs/screenshots/discovered_devices_example.PNG: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/NordicSemiconductor/pc-nrfconnect-ble/HEAD/doc/docs/screenshots/discovered_devices_example.PNG -------------------------------------------------------------------------------- /doc/docs/screenshots/expand-collapse.png: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/NordicSemiconductor/pc-nrfconnect-ble/HEAD/doc/docs/screenshots/expand-collapse.png -------------------------------------------------------------------------------- /doc/docs/screenshots/nRF_Connect_enable_notifications.png: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/NordicSemiconductor/pc-nrfconnect-ble/HEAD/doc/docs/screenshots/nRF_Connect_enable_notifications.png -------------------------------------------------------------------------------- /doc/docs/screenshots/nRF_Connect_for_Desktop_BLE_about.png: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/NordicSemiconductor/pc-nrfconnect-ble/HEAD/doc/docs/screenshots/nRF_Connect_for_Desktop_BLE_about.png -------------------------------------------------------------------------------- /doc/docs/screenshots/nRF_connect_advertising_setup.png: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/NordicSemiconductor/pc-nrfconnect-ble/HEAD/doc/docs/screenshots/nRF_connect_advertising_setup.png -------------------------------------------------------------------------------- /doc/docs/screenshots/nRF_connect_app_window.png: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/NordicSemiconductor/pc-nrfconnect-ble/HEAD/doc/docs/screenshots/nRF_connect_app_window.png -------------------------------------------------------------------------------- /doc/docs/screenshots/nRF_connect_dfu_completed.png: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/NordicSemiconductor/pc-nrfconnect-ble/HEAD/doc/docs/screenshots/nRF_connect_dfu_completed.png -------------------------------------------------------------------------------- /doc/docs/screenshots/nRF_connect_dfu_progress.png: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/NordicSemiconductor/pc-nrfconnect-ble/HEAD/doc/docs/screenshots/nRF_connect_dfu_progress.png -------------------------------------------------------------------------------- /doc/docs/screenshots/nRF_connect_dfu_start.png: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/NordicSemiconductor/pc-nrfconnect-ble/HEAD/doc/docs/screenshots/nRF_connect_dfu_start.png -------------------------------------------------------------------------------- /doc/docs/screenshots/nRF_connect_discovered_services.png: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/NordicSemiconductor/pc-nrfconnect-ble/HEAD/doc/docs/screenshots/nRF_connect_discovered_services.png -------------------------------------------------------------------------------- /doc/docs/screenshots/nRF_connect_hovering_over_padlock.png: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/NordicSemiconductor/pc-nrfconnect-ble/HEAD/doc/docs/screenshots/nRF_connect_hovering_over_padlock.png -------------------------------------------------------------------------------- /doc/docs/screenshots/nRF_connect_local_device.png: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/NordicSemiconductor/pc-nrfconnect-ble/HEAD/doc/docs/screenshots/nRF_connect_local_device.png -------------------------------------------------------------------------------- /doc/docs/screenshots/nRF_connect_pairing.png: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/NordicSemiconductor/pc-nrfconnect-ble/HEAD/doc/docs/screenshots/nRF_connect_pairing.png -------------------------------------------------------------------------------- /doc/docs/screenshots/nRF_connect_secure_dfu.png: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/NordicSemiconductor/pc-nrfconnect-ble/HEAD/doc/docs/screenshots/nRF_connect_secure_dfu.png -------------------------------------------------------------------------------- /doc/docs/screenshots/nRF_connect_server_setup.png: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/NordicSemiconductor/pc-nrfconnect-ble/HEAD/doc/docs/screenshots/nRF_connect_server_setup.png -------------------------------------------------------------------------------- /doc/docs/screenshots/nRF_connect_servicedetails.png: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/NordicSemiconductor/pc-nrfconnect-ble/HEAD/doc/docs/screenshots/nRF_connect_servicedetails.png -------------------------------------------------------------------------------- /doc/docs/screenshots/nRF_connect_update_connection.png: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/NordicSemiconductor/pc-nrfconnect-ble/HEAD/doc/docs/screenshots/nRF_connect_update_connection.png -------------------------------------------------------------------------------- /doc/docs/screenshots/nrfconnect_ble_program_prompt.png: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/NordicSemiconductor/pc-nrfconnect-ble/HEAD/doc/docs/screenshots/nrfconnect_ble_program_prompt.png -------------------------------------------------------------------------------- /doc/docs/screenshots/padlock_encrypted.png: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/NordicSemiconductor/pc-nrfconnect-ble/HEAD/doc/docs/screenshots/padlock_encrypted.png -------------------------------------------------------------------------------- /doc/docs/screenshots/padlock_unencrypted.png: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/NordicSemiconductor/pc-nrfconnect-ble/HEAD/doc/docs/screenshots/padlock_unencrypted.png -------------------------------------------------------------------------------- /doc/docs/screenshots/server_setup.PNG: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/NordicSemiconductor/pc-nrfconnect-ble/HEAD/doc/docs/screenshots/server_setup.PNG -------------------------------------------------------------------------------- /doc/docs/service_discovery.md: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/NordicSemiconductor/pc-nrfconnect-ble/HEAD/doc/docs/service_discovery.md -------------------------------------------------------------------------------- /doc/docs/setting_up_application.md: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/NordicSemiconductor/pc-nrfconnect-ble/HEAD/doc/docs/setting_up_application.md -------------------------------------------------------------------------------- /doc/docs/troubleshooting.md: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/NordicSemiconductor/pc-nrfconnect-ble/HEAD/doc/docs/troubleshooting.md -------------------------------------------------------------------------------- /doc/docs/update_connection.md: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/NordicSemiconductor/pc-nrfconnect-ble/HEAD/doc/docs/update_connection.md -------------------------------------------------------------------------------- /doc/mkdocs.yml: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/NordicSemiconductor/pc-nrfconnect-ble/HEAD/doc/mkdocs.yml -------------------------------------------------------------------------------- /doc/zoomin/custom.properties: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/NordicSemiconductor/pc-nrfconnect-ble/HEAD/doc/zoomin/custom.properties -------------------------------------------------------------------------------- /doc/zoomin/tags.yml: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/NordicSemiconductor/pc-nrfconnect-ble/HEAD/doc/zoomin/tags.yml -------------------------------------------------------------------------------- /jest.config.js: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/NordicSemiconductor/pc-nrfconnect-ble/HEAD/jest.config.js -------------------------------------------------------------------------------- /package.json: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/NordicSemiconductor/pc-nrfconnect-ble/HEAD/package.json -------------------------------------------------------------------------------- /resources/dfu_icon.png: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/NordicSemiconductor/pc-nrfconnect-ble/HEAD/resources/dfu_icon.png -------------------------------------------------------------------------------- /resources/icon.icns: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/NordicSemiconductor/pc-nrfconnect-ble/HEAD/resources/icon.icns -------------------------------------------------------------------------------- /resources/icon.ico: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/NordicSemiconductor/pc-nrfconnect-ble/HEAD/resources/icon.ico -------------------------------------------------------------------------------- /resources/icon.png: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/NordicSemiconductor/pc-nrfconnect-ble/HEAD/resources/icon.png -------------------------------------------------------------------------------- /resources/icon.svg: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/NordicSemiconductor/pc-nrfconnect-ble/HEAD/resources/icon.svg -------------------------------------------------------------------------------- /resources/screenshot.gif: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/NordicSemiconductor/pc-nrfconnect-ble/HEAD/resources/screenshot.gif -------------------------------------------------------------------------------- /src/config.ts: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/NordicSemiconductor/pc-nrfconnect-ble/HEAD/src/config.ts -------------------------------------------------------------------------------- /src/downloadInstaller.ts: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/NordicSemiconductor/pc-nrfconnect-ble/HEAD/src/downloadInstaller.ts -------------------------------------------------------------------------------- /src/index.tsx: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/NordicSemiconductor/pc-nrfconnect-ble/HEAD/src/index.tsx -------------------------------------------------------------------------------- /src/paths.ts: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/NordicSemiconductor/pc-nrfconnect-ble/HEAD/src/paths.ts -------------------------------------------------------------------------------- /src/run.ts: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/NordicSemiconductor/pc-nrfconnect-ble/HEAD/src/run.ts -------------------------------------------------------------------------------- /src/style.css: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/NordicSemiconductor/pc-nrfconnect-ble/HEAD/src/style.css -------------------------------------------------------------------------------- /tsconfig.json: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/NordicSemiconductor/pc-nrfconnect-ble/HEAD/tsconfig.json --------------------------------------------------------------------------------